Technical Director II, PQI Technology

At Electronic Arts, Player & Quality Insights (PQI) is transforming how we deliver quality, insights, and player experiences at scale. Technology is central to this transformation, enabling faster decisions, scalable quality, and new pathways to player and market growth.

As Technical Director II for PQI, you will define and lead the technology strategy that powers our end-to-end player and platform insights, quality, and certification ecosystem. You will drive the adoption of AI, automation, and scalable platforms to accelerate insight to impact, improve player experiences, and unlock efficiency across EA’s portfolio.

You will operate as an enterprise technology leader, partnering across the PQI and Quality, Verification and Standards (QVS) organizations to align strategy, prioritize investments, and deliver measurable business impact.

Core Responsibilities
  • Define and Drive PQI Technology Strategy
    Own and execute PQI’s technology vision aligned to the PQI strategic pillars. Create a clear roadmap and success metrics across AI, automation, data, and platforms that accelerate decision-making and scale quality across the portfolio.
  • Engineering Practices
    Elevate engineering best practices, product quality, and release readiness to deliver measurable business impact.
  • Lead AI and Automation Transformation
    Drive adoption of AI technologies, including LLMs, computer vision, and agentic systems to automate workflows, enhance quality validation, and unlock efficiency at scale.
  • Technical Integration & Impact
    Act as the connective layer between technology, insights, standards, and operations. Align roadmaps, integrate systems, and ensure technology investments directly support studio outcomes, player experience, and business impact.
  • Enable a Scalable Operating Model
    Partner with Tech Operations and PQI leadership to ensure strong delivery governance, resource planning, and operational cadence. Drive predictable execution and measurable outcomes across all technology initiatives.
Qualifications
  • Proven strategic leadership of engineering teams, with a track record of defining and delivering multi-year strategies.
  • 10+ years of experience in software engineering, platform development, or technical systems, with significant leadership experience
  • Proven track record in building and scaling platforms, data systems, or AI-driven solutions in complex environments
  • Experience driving technology strategy and execution across multiple teams or products
  • Strong expertise in system architecture, cloud platforms, data systems, and modern engineering practices
  • Experience applying AI, automation, or data-driven systems to real-world business problems
  • Translate complex technical concepts into clear business impact and strategic direction
  • Strong cross-functional leadership across product, analytics, operations, and creative teams
Pay Transparency - North America

Compensation And Benefits

The ranges listed below are what EA in good faith expects to pay applicants for this role in these locations at the time of this posting. If you reside in a different location, a recruiter will advise on the applicable range and benefits. Pay offered will be determined based on a number of relevant business and candidate factors (e.g. education, qualifications, certifications, experience, skills, geographic location, or business needs).

PAY RANGES
  • British Columbia (depending on location e.g. Vancouver vs. Victoria) *$169,500 - $242,600 CAD

Pay is just one part of the overall compensation at EA.

For Canada, we offer a package of benefits including vacation (3 weeks per year to start), 10 days per year of sick time, paid top-up to EI/QPIP benefits up to 100% of base salary when you welcome a new child (12 weeks for maternity, and 4 weeks for parental/adoption leave), extended health/dental/vision coverage, life insurance, disability insurance, retirement plan to regular full-time employees. Certain roles may also be eligible for bonus and other incentive programs.
